Base Program Details

The Base Program package is for pups who struggle with mild to moderate reactivity with 1 trigger (for example, reactive to dogs on walks), folks who want to start the cooperative care journey, or dogs who experience mild fear/uncertainties in 1 or 2 specific scenarios.

Our packages are designed to honour your dog as an individual and the nature of behaviour that is multi-faceted, complex, and deep-rooted. Longer term packages are available upon request and all packages include ongoing support from your trainer between scheduled sessions. Behaviour Modification Packages give you the professional support needed, from experienced trainers who are skilled at providing effective and ethical treatment for serious behavioural concerns.

 

Why virtual? Virtual sessions allow you and your pup to work in the comfort of your own environment with the support of a professional trainer guiding you through every step. This is a great option for pups who struggle with new humans in their environment, individuals who live outside of our service area, or folks with a busy schedule. Virtual sessions allow us to work with your pup as “organically” as possible. Most behaviours can be effectively and comprehensively addressed through some or all of our sessions taking place virtually. Hybrid (a combination of virtual and in home) packages are also available and can be curated in consultation with your trainer.
